The Road to Rio- Brazil’s Forced Removals

The Road to Rio- Brazil’s Forced Removals was made by Institute of Commonwealth Studies’ 2011-12 students Helle Abelvik-Lawson, David Langle and Rose Leifer (HRBA Productions). This short film explores the infrastructure development plans for the Rio de Janeiro’s 2014 World Cup and 2016 Olympics. Plans for these upcoming events are threatening and destroying favela communities with forced evictions.

Find out more from Catalytic Communities- http://www.catcomm.org- whose footage featured in this film. Catalytic Communities is a favela resident empowerment organisation in Rio. They have a program called Rio on Watch which monitors evictions and trains community journalists to report on housing rights violations in Rio ahead of these two major events.
